Qantas terminal evacuated after security lapse
A security breach prompted the evacuation of the Qantas domestic terminal at the Brisbane Airport yesterday.
A group of passengers walked through a secure area without being screened about 3:30pm AEST.
The terminal was evacuated as a precaution and hundreds of passengers were re-screened.
A Brisbane Airport Corporation spokeswoman said at least 14 Qantas flights were expected to be delayed.
Jetstar and Virgin flights were not affected.
